Anarchy Coffee’s Brasil Cerrado Mineiro Ipê is bold, funky, and packed with juicy character. Notes of red wine and sweet nectarine create a rich, fruit-forward cup with plenty of natural sweetness and a smooth finish. Naturally processed by the Barbosa family, this light roast is a fun and vibrant take on classic Brazilian coffee.

We're passionate about fresh, flavourful coffee and we know you are too. For the best taste, enjoy your coffee within approximately 6 weeks of the roast date.
Coffee naturally oxidizes slowly over time, but it can still be enjoyed beyond this window. Any beans older than six weeks from roast are clearly marked and automatically discounted, giving you a great value on quality coffee.
